First step was to heat emboss the stripes in white on the watercolor paper .  From there I added color with an aqua painter and Pool Party ink pad .  Some areas came out darker which I really like. The flowers are watercolor as well and fussy cut.  Each was stamped with Grapefruit Grove then softened with the aqua painter .  They are layered under and over the sentiment that is heat embossed on watercolor paper as well. Watercolor Cactus

Image
If  you look at my recent posts, you may notice that I am really into the new Flowering Desert stamp set.  Today's idea is a little different.  I went with water color using an aqua painter and ink pads. I love the water color effect.  It's soft and has beautiful color variations.  I achieved this look very easily with just a few steps. I stamped the cactus with Lemon Lime Twist on water color paper.  Using the aqua painter, I went over the original image to get the initial water color look.  Then with Granny Apple Green I added in more color gradually shading from the left to right.  In areas that I wanted a darker bit of color, I waited until the area was dry then layered on more. Once I had the color the way I wanted it, I used my Light Shaded Spruce Stampin' Blend marker and added detail.
